The Urban Learning Academy recognises the power of adult learning and the need for the provision of learning opportunities to be accessible to everyone in our community. The head of UNESCO stated that “the ultimate twenty-first century skill is the ability to learn” and yet for many that is very hard to do. A November 2022 report from the Learning and Work institute said that “making learning more flexible, accessible and affordable is important, but not enough. We also need to make sure learning is relevant to people’s lives, communicate the benefits, and “build a culture of learning”.

Evidence tells us that adult learning contributes to a healthy and productive society and yet the national adult learning budget had been cut by 50% in the last decade. The vision of the ULA is to harness Exeter’s passion, creativity and entrepreneurship to provide inclusive learning opportunities for everyone in the community.

Research tells us that people from disadvantaged communities are less likely to access adult learning and that inequality of provision is increasing. The ULA will work to change this in Exeter. In services there has been a narrative that people are ‘hard to reach’ in our experience they aren’t – it is our services and our opportunities that are hard to reach. We hope the ULA will work across the city to provide hundreds of different ways for people to access learning in a way and at a time that is right for them.
